Learning outcomes (list)
The student calculates the distance/ speed/ acceleration starting from data with linear, compound and rotary movements. |
The student determines the labour and power of a moving (linear or rotary) object. |
The student calculates the tension (pull/ push/ slide or a combination) of loaded tool components. |
The student calculates the permitted tension in function of the way of pressure for the given type of material and compares this with the occurred tension. |
The student chooses the appropriate profile based on a case with regard to bending with the help of schedules. |
The student calculates the torsion which occurs in beams and axis under pressure and compares these with a safe torsion. |
The student applies the thermodynamic behaviour of open, closed and isolated systems and circular processes on industrial processes |
The student analyses the processes where "energy" plays a part and finds a connection with processes from the industry. |
The student puts together powers to their resultant and disintegrates a power according to perpendicular axis in an arithmetic and schematic way |
The student calculates the size and sense of a moment of couple judging by power(s) and geometry. |
